Romsey is a historic market town and civil parish in the Test Valley district of Hampshire, England, situated in the south of the country on the River Test. It lies about 7miles northwest of Southampton and 11miles southwest of Winchester, with the scenic New Forest nearby. The town has a population of around 15,000–20,000 residents and serves as one of the principal towns in the borough. Romsey’s roots reach back over a thousand years, and its heritage is reflected in landmarks such as Romsey Abbey, a large Norman church that dominates the town centre, medieval buildings like King John’s House, and historic sites like Broadlands - once home to notable figures including British Prime Minister Lord Palmerston and statesman Lord Mountbatten. The town combines its rich history with a lively present: Traditional markets have taken place since the 11th century, and today Romsey offers a mix of independent shops, cafés, community events, and cultural attractions. Its riverside setting on the Test, famous for trout fishing, and its proximity to countryside walking and gardens make it appealing for both residents and visitors.
